 What the HR Generalist II Does Each Day:

  • Conducts onboarding activities including new-hire orientation
  • Maintains human resource information system records and compiles reports from the database; Maintain HRIS accuracy and compliance documentation
  • Provides frontline HR support to employees and managers
  • Supports the planning and execution of employee town halls
  • Lead and execute employee engagement initiatives
  • Assists with the administration of employee leave of absences
  • Partners with payroll/benefits to resolve escalated issues
  • Administers various human resource plans and procedures for all organization personnel; assists in the development and implementation of personnel policies and procedures
  • Participate in developing department goals, objectives and systems
  • Supports administration of the compensation program; monitors the performance evaluation program
  • Conducts exit interviews and report trends
  • Support employee relations investigations
  • Maintains compliance with federal, state and local employment and benefits laws and regulations
  • Supports and advises supervisors on employee relations issues
  • Facilitates performance management and goal-setting processes
  • Supports HR projects (policy updates, engagement initiatives, compliance audits)

       About Quva:

       Quva provides industry-leading health-system pharmacy services and solutions, including 503B sterile injectable outsourcing services and AI-based data software solutions that help power the business of pharmacy. Quva Pharma’s multiple production facilities and industry-first dedicated remote distribution capabilities provide ready-to-administer sterile injectable medicines critical to patient care. Quva BrightStream partners with health systems to aggregate, normalize, and analyze large amounts of complex data across their sites of care, and through proprietary machine learning, transforms data into actionable insights supporting revenue optimization, script capture, inventory management, drug shortage control, and more. Quva’s overall progressive and integrated platform helps health-systems transform pharmacy management to achieve greater value and deliver highest-quality patient care.

      What We Do

      QuVa Pharma is a leader in 503B outsourced compounding, serving all 50 states with a full portfolio of sterile, ready-to-administer injectable products. QuVa was purpose-built to change the 503B industry for the better and is leading the way in making it more safe, efficient, and reliable. With unmatched expertise in cGMPs and sterile pharmaceutical manufacturing, we achieve higher than required quality and safety standards and maintain a leading FDA compliance record, so hospitals can more confidently and reliably focus on patient care. While our leading cGMP processes, sterile-to-sterile portfolio, and expansive capacity of 300,000 sq ft across four facilities are the foundation of success, it is our transparency, customer-focused service, and contracted supply arrangements that enable us to help hospitals and health systems better meet their patient care and operational needs. As FDA compliance becomes more stringent, QuVa's ability to reliably supply the highest-quality products is more valuable than ever and allows hospitals to spend more time on patient care and less time worried about beyond use dates, waste, workload inefficiencies, and compliance.
